Electrical System Overview

Rwanda uses Type C and Type J electrical plugs and sockets. The standard voltage is 230V and the frequency is 50Hz. Travelers from the US and other 110-120V countries should check if their devices support dual voltage before plugging in.

Plug Types Used in Rwanda

C

Type C (Europlug) Primary

220-240V 50Hz 2.5A Ungrounded

Pins: 2 round pins

Type C plug
J

Type J

220-240V 50Hz 10A Grounded

Pins: 3 round pins
